The Nuanced Impact of AI on Job Markets
The prevailing narrative often paints AI as a job-destroying force. However, the latest research suggests a more complex picture. Occupations with a high degree of routine, less-skilled tasks exposed to AI automation, such as basic administration or data entry, have seen a notable decline in job postings, averaging a 6.1% decrease. This indicates a clear shift away from labor-intensive, repetitive roles. Conversely, when AI automates the more specialized, cognitively demanding tasks, the impact on wages can be detrimental, as the remaining work no longer requires scarce expertise. This can affect roles like junior software engineers, leading to wage stagnation or even decline.
AI Augmentation: Boosting Specialized Roles
The study highlights a critical distinction: when AI automates routine aspects of a job, the remaining work tends to become more specialized. For instance, a human resources specialist whose administrative duties are handled by AI can then focus on complex employee relations and strategic decision-making. This augmentation of human capabilities by AI is expected to drive productivity gains and potentially increase wages in these specialized fields. The key lies in identifying which tasks AI can undertake efficiently, allowing human workers to elevate their roles and focus on uniquely human skills like creativity, critical thinking, and emotional intelligence.
Expert Opinions from the Forefront of AI and Employment
The discourse surrounding AI’s influence on employment is multifaceted, with experts offering diverse perspectives. A report from King’s College London emphasizes that “Workers in occupations where AI may automate high expertise tasks face most acute wage pressures.” This underscores the need for targeted reskilling and upskilling initiatives. Dr. Bouke Klein Teeselink suggests that “Training programs could target these workers with curricula focused on skills that remain difficult for AI to replicate, particularly those involving judgment, creativity, and interpersonal interaction.” Conversely, in roles where AI handles low-expertise tasks, policies encouraging AI adoption can lead to productivity gains without significant labor displacement.
The World Economic Forum also weighs in, stating that “AI is fundamentally transforming the global job market, driving profound changes in skill requirements, entire professions, and wage structure.” They advocate for “large-scale investment in lifelong learning and skills” as the primary safeguard against disruption. This perspective is echoed by research indicating that AI skills themselves are becoming increasingly valuable, often outperforming traditional educational qualifications in the immediate labor market. Businesses are shifting towards skills-based hiring, recognizing that targeted skill acquisition can significantly boost wages and offer a competitive advantage.

Price Prediction: Navigating the Future of Work
Predicting the precise trajectory of AI’s impact on wages and job security is complex, as it varies significantly by industry and region. However, the general consensus points towards a continued evolution of the job market rather than mass unemployment. While some entry-level roles may be automated, leading to challenges for recent graduates, new specialist roles are emerging. The emphasis will be on adaptability, continuous learning, and the cultivation of uniquely human skills that complement AI capabilities.
[YOUTUBE VIDEO EMBED]
The International Monetary Fund (IMF) has warned that young people may be particularly vulnerable as an “AI tsunami” could impact many entry-level roles. However, a 2025 report from the Brookings Institution suggests that AI adoption has generally led to employment and firm growth, with no widespread job losses reported. This indicates that the impact is uneven and heavily dependent on industry-specific adoption rates and how businesses redesign their workflows.
